The Indianapolis Parenteral Manufacturing (IPM) HSE organization provides Health, Safety and Environmental support and expertise to a large manufacturing organization producing sterile medicine for patients around the world. Responsibilities: The position requires a highly-motivated candidate with strong teamwork and communication skills. The position will provide HSE support for manufacturing areas, Capital Projects and program ownership for HSE aspects and projects. Provide daily HSE support to assigned areas, including metrics data and recommendations for continuous HSE improvement Act as subject matter expert for HSE aspects and prepares detailed HSE aspect self-assessments including opportunities for improvement, actions to close gaps and continuous improvement of the aspect Provide project support, including initial HSE impact assessment for change controls to ensure thorough implementation of required HSE aspects and actions Collaborate and influence cross-functional leadership and area employees to ensure a strong safety culture to keep IPM employees safe Maintain HSE compliance with IPM procedures, Global HSE Standards and all applicable external regulations. Provide HSE subject-matter expertise for incident investigations, area change controls and HSE functional initiatives Actively assist on site governance and area safety teams, helping develop and track key performance indicators to monitor results and drive improvement action when needed Leads development of digital tools and automation to improve management of HSE data and visualization Basic Qualifications: Bachelors Degree required. Prefer degree in Engineering, Industrial Safety, Industrial Hygiene or other STEM field 5 years of HSE experience in a manufacturing environment Qualified applicants must be authorized to work in the United States on a full-time basis. Lilly will not provide support for or sponsor work authorization or visas for this role, including but not limited to F-1 CPT, F-1 OPT, F-1 STEM OPT, J-1, H-1B, TN, O-1, E-3, H-1B1, or L-1. Additional Skills/Preferences: Previous work experience in Health, Safety and Environmental Knowledge and familiarity with HSE regulations, codes and standards (OSHA, ANSI, NFPA, etc.) HSE experience including deep technical knowledge in high-risk aspects, including Lockout/Tagout, Confined Space Entry, Fall Protection/Prevention, Machine/Equipment Safeguarding Strong analytical and problem-solving capabilities with ability to synthesize complex technical information and develop practical solutions Project management skills including capability to manage multiple projects simultaneously while incorporating cross-functional stakeholder engagement Strong communication skills, both verbal and written Effective interpersonal and relationship building skills Knowledge and familiarity with HSE data and metrics, including experience with data visualization tools and dashboards Previous experience supporting or working in manufacturing areas Additional Information: Minimal travel may be required (0 - 10%) Normal work shift is M-F, 8 hours per day. This role supports a 24/7 operational area. Flexibility to provide occasional in-person and phone support outside of the normal work shift is required Tasks will require entering manufacturing and laboratory areas, which require wearing appropriate PPE Lilly is dedicated to helping individuals with disabilities to actively engage in the workforce, ensuring equal opportunities when vying for positions.
